Qualify for the WSOP Main Event in the Eurobet.com $70k Poker Points trade in
By SOP newswire2
The Eurobet.com $70,000 Poker Points trade-in promotion is now in full swing and gearing up to give away its ultimate prize - qualifiers to the World Series of Poker (WSOP) 2009 Main Event.
Playing out on Friday 15 and Sunday, 17 May 2009 at 19.30 (GMT), the WSOP package includes the Main Event buy-in worth $10,000 as well as $2,500 placed in the players account for travel and accommodation expenses.
The prize allows players of Eurobet.com`s existing loyalty programme the chance to trade-in their Poker Points for tickets before 1 June when their points will be rest to zero to make way for the company`s new Loyalty Scheme offering players more bonuses, tournaments, freerolls and live exclusive events.
From now until 31 May 2009, all existing members have to do is login and go to the "Poker Points` tab of the Cashier` to establish their current balance and see all events they are able to cash in their points for.
